Natillas Piuranas (caramelized Milk Pudding) Recipe

Yield: 8 servings
Recipe by luhu.jp

Ingredients:
15 ounce: Condensed milk, canned
1 cup: Dark brown sugar,
3 cup: Milk, fresh
1/4 cup: Water,
1/2 tsp: Baking soda,

Directions:
In a small saucepan, bring the condensed milk, fresh milk and soda
just to the boil over high heat, stirring constantly. Immediately
remove pan from the heat. Combine the sugar and water in a heavy 4
to 5 quart saucepan and cook them over low heat, stirring constantly,
until the sugar dissolves. Pour in the hot milk and stir well. Cook
over very low heat for 1 hour and 15 minutes, stirring occasionally,
watching carefully for any sign of burning and regulating the heat
accordingly. The mixture will become a thick amber-colored pudding.
Serve the pudding at room temperature, or refrigerate it and serve it
chilled.
